Despite a recorded 911 call and witness accounts to the contrary, George Zimmerman decided to tell police that 17-year-old Trayvon Martin attacked him first, approaching him from behind as he attempted to walk back to his vehicle. From the AP: “The two exchanged words, Zimmerman said, and Martin then punched him, jumped on top of him and began banging his head on a sidewalk. Zimmerman said he began crying for help; Martin’s family thinks it was their son who was crying out. Witness accounts differ and 911 tapes in which the voices are heard are not clear.” There are two sides to every story, except when one of the people involved is dead and can’t tell theirs.
Meanwhile, thousands gathered at the Capitol Monday evening to protest Georgia’s “Stand Your Ground Law” in Martin’s name. Photos on Fresh Loaf soon.
